state the dimensions. All the bars were cast 15 inches long and in breaking them for transverse strength they rested on pointed supports, 12 inches centers. The last two columns in the Tables give the computed relative strength. The outside column is used only for the half-inch square bars, so as to illustrate two methods of figuring, and is obtained by multiplying the breaking load by eight, a method advanced by some, for one-half-inch bars.* The inner is obtained by the rules shown in Chapter LXL, page 476. The area of a bar 1.1284 inch in diameter is equal to the area of one inch square; by keeping this in mind the figures in the micrometer columns can have their relation to a square inch readily denned.
